Burberry Prorsum
The autumn/winter collection from the Brit’s Burberry Prorsum began with models sauntering out to an Misty Miller’s accusative cover of The Turtles’ classically sweet song "Happy Together." It was the perfect sound to accompany romantic heart patterns and classic animal prints—jaguar, giraffe and leopard. Oh, my! To be sure, the brand’s signature trench coats continue to inspire American designers who long for that London fog, and navy blue, black and camel are the cornerstone of the collection’s outerwear. But even this international brand took some risk in this collection with sheer, rubber skirts, tops and jackets. A chance to show off this fall? Absolutely.

Donna Karan
It’s all drama with Donna this fall, and nothing plays the part better than jersey. An effortless jersey body-dress with a sheer inset at the waist, covered by a matching stretch jersey wrap, avoids being "matchy-matchy" by celebrating the bold and beautiful quality of confidence. Karan brings a bounty of capes and shapes, asymmetrical and sweeping, to her 2013 collection. An interesting use of leather throughout, and plenty of layers are functional in the season’s more loved palette: black.

Jason Wu
Michelle Obama famously wore Wu to two inauguration balls, and who would have thought that things could get more feminine than dressing our First Lady? In this collection, which Wu calls "Extreme Femininity," natural beauty comes into focus by virtue of synched waist lines, strong shoulders and immaculate tailoring. Suits in black and white, a fur coat or collar, are all that’s needed to feel powerful, assertive and beautiful this winter.

Valentino
Back-to-school fashion is all tongue and cheek with Valentino this season, which is focusing on daywear in a singular collection for the first time. The theme is incredibly sophisticated, drawn from seventeenth and eighteenth century archeological oddities like shells, sea creatures and taxidermy. These delicate motifs appear throughout in subtle and significant moments like the zodiac signs appearing on purses or a herringbone pencil skirt. Sophisticated looks incredible this fall season in elegant and thought-provoking design.

Micheal Kors
After appearing on Bravo’s "Project Runway," this American designer quickly became a household name for watches, clothes and jewelry—the all-American, tan voice of fashion. An advocate of American sportswear, military and urban influences have shaped this color-blocked collection into a suspiciously androgynous story. Intriguing bits of camouflage make their way into the collection, along with quilted purses and over-sized sunglasses. Masculinity looks great in electric blue, taxicab yellow and couture that’s both easy and ready-to-wear.
